PopKTV Karaoke Lounge Opens in Chinatown

By Casey Cora | April 17, 2014 7:41am
 The new lounge features 11 swanky private rooms for group karaoke.

CHINATOWN — A sleek new karaoke lounge has opened in the Richland Center plaza near Chinatown Square.

"Everybody is looking for a place to relax on the weekend," PopKTV manager Linda Sui said.

An upfront area at PopKTV, located on the second floor at 2002 S. Wentworth Ave., has a handful of small cocktail tables, a bar and black leather furniture, all facing a small stage.

But that's sort of an opening act for the main event.

The lounge features 11 private rooms where party-goers can sing their hearts out.

For $38 an hour, patrons can rent the spacious rooms — complete with LED disco-lighting, funky lamps, flat-screen TVs, elevated stages and leather couches — and make use of the high-tech touch screens to select karaoke songs. Each room can fit up to 15 people.

"We're the biggest in Chinatown," Sui said.

Sui said song selections will be available in Chinese, English and Spanish.

Bartenders will keep the party fueled with beer, wine and cocktails, plus a menu full of traditional Chinese barbecue favorites like lamb and beef and an assortment of noodle soups. 

Although the business is technically already open, PopKTV is still working out some kinks — the food and drink menus aren't printed yet, the bar was only stocked with vodka and it's not completely staffed.

Still, Sui said it took a long eight months to renovate the former office space and "everybody here is very excited to open."

A grand opening bash is scheduled for April 26.
